SG Americas Securities LLC reduced its stake in shares of Qudian Inc. (NYSE:QD – Free Report) by 6.2% during the third qu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 272,606 shares of the company’s stock after selling 18,121 shares during the period. SG Americas Securities LLC owned 0.14% of Qudian worth $581,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Qudian Stock Down 0.5 %
Shares of QD stock opened at $2.11 on Tuesday. The company’s fifty day simple moving average is $1.89 and its two-hundred day simple moving average is $1.98. Qudian Inc. has a 52 week low of $1.52 and a 52 week high of $2.60. The stock has a market cap of $423.27 million, a P/E ratio of -7.03 and a beta of 0.62.
About Qudian
Qudian Inc operates as a consumer-oriented technology company in the People's Republic of China. The company engages in the operation of online platforms to provide small consumer credit products. It also provides technology development and services; research and development services; and delivery services.
